By The Book: 2020 Singapore Literature Prize Awards Ceremony goes virtual this August, with 52 shortlisted works

A total of 52 works have been shortlisted for the biennial Singapore Literature Prize (SLP), Singapore’s top literary award. For the first time in the history of the SLP, the awards ceremony will be held online via the Singapore Book Council’s Facebook and YouTube pages on 27th August 2020 at 8pm. Singapore Sports Hub celebrates fifth anniversary with lineup of virtual activities for the community

The Singapore Sports Hub is commemorating its fifth anniversary this July with a month-long virtual celebration, culminating with the National Day Fiesta on 9th August.
